Preguntas frecuentes sobre Roosevelt Park

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Roosevelt Park?

Actualmente hay 113 Apartamentos Estudios en Roosevelt Park con alquileres que van desde $950 hasta $3,402, con un precio medio de $1,768.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Roosevelt Park?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Roosevelt Park varian entre $895 y $3,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,683

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Roosevelt Park?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Roosevelt Park van desde $974 hasta $3,275.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,858

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Roosevelt Park?

En estos momentos hay 42 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Roosevelt Park en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$810 y $2,975 - con una media de $1,674 para el lugar.
